# Env config for Marrowgate's reporting DB — weekly eng sync notes.
# As of sprint 41 we partition the events table by month instead of
# quarterly; PARTITION_WINDOW=monthly reflects that below. The rollover
# job creates next month's partition on the 25th. Don't change the
# window without flagging it at sync. The rollover job authenticates
# against the admin socket using the secret defined on the next line.

env line for fafof-fahag: LEDGER_TOKEN5=f8790

// REINDEX_BATCH_CAP limits docs per shard pass in the Tallowfield
// nightly search reindex. Raising it starves the ingest queue;
// lowering it overruns the maintenance window. 5000 is the tested
// sweet spot. Change only with a soak run. Verified against the
// build noted below.

session token of bawif-hahog = htk6_ac5981

Action item: The Relayn deploy-status bot silently dropped updates when the pipeline API paginated results, so responders believed a rollback had completed when it had not. We will add pagination handling, a staleness banner, and an integration test. Until merged, verify deploy state directly in the pipeline console, documented at the page below.

runbook for kahop-kajop: https://rundeck.ordinio.test/display/secrets/pipeline/issue/pages/repo/browse/e5732776e07d1285107e5aeb

## Escalation: Flaky DNS in Plugin Sandbox

If your Quillhook plugin intermittently fails to resolve `registry.internal`, retry with backoff first. Still failing after three attempts? Capture the resolver log, note your plugin ID and region, and check the Lanternfall status board. If unresolved within 30 minutes, escalate to the platform team directly.

escalation mailbox, bafog-fafog: ulador@paliqlabs.internal

Subject: Encoding detection cut-over — done!

Hi plugin folks,

The switch to the new charset sniffer in TextHarbor went live last night. Uploaded files now get detected via the Lindqvist heuristic first, with the old byte-frequency fallback second. Most plugins won't notice, but if you override detection hooks, please retest with UTF-16 samples. For reference, the detection service now runs with the following settings.

config for kafof-bawef:
holath:
  log_level: debug
  metrics_host: metrics.holath.qorvelsys.internal
  pin: 2191
  pool_size: 32